1. What is CPU time?
CPU time is the total amount of time the CPU spends executing a program or process.
2. Why is CPU time important?
CPU time is important because it helps measure the performance and efficiency of a program or system.
3. What factors affect CPU time?
Factors that affect CPU time include the complexity of the program, the number of instructions, and the clock speed of the CPU.
4. How is clock cycle time determined?
Clock cycle time is determined by the frequency of the CPU, which is measured in Hertz.
5. What is the formula for calculating CPU time?
The formula for calculating CPU time is CPU time = (clock cycles) x (clock cycle time).
6. How does the number of clock cycles affect CPU time?
The more clock cycles required to execute a program, the longer the CPU time will be.
7. How does the clock cycle time affect CPU time?
A shorter clock cycle time will result in faster CPU time, while a longer clock cycle time will result in slower CPU time.
8. Can CPU time be negative?
No, CPU time cannot be negative as it represents the actual time spent executing a program.
9. What is the relationship between CPU time and performance?
CPU time and performance are inversely related – the lower the CPU time, the better the performance.
10. How can CPU time be improved?
CPU time can be improved by optimizing the program code, reducing the number of instructions, and increasing the clock speed of the CPU.
11. Is CPU time the same as wall clock time?
No, CPU time measures the actual time the CPU spends executing a program, while wall clock time includes all the time taken for input/output operations and other system tasks.
12. How is CPU time different from real time?
CPU time measures the time spent executing a program on the CPU, while real time is the actual time elapsed in the real world.